Photosynthesis and nutrient-use efficiency in response to N and P addition in three dominant grassland species on the semiarid Loess Plateau

Understanding the ecophysiological and nutrient-use strategies of dominant species is important for clarifying plant growth and an ecological process in their community under unbalanced N and P inputs. This study investigated effects of N and P addition main plot: 0, 25, 50, and 100 kg(N) ha -1 year -1 ; subplot: 0, 20, 40, and 80 kg(P) ha -1 year -1 on leaf N and P contents (LNC a and LPC a ), photosynthetic capacity ( P Nmax ) and photosynthetic N- and P-use efficiencies (PNUE and PPUE) in three species ( Stipa bungeana , Bothriochloa ischaemum , and Lespedeza davurica ) in a semiarid grassland in China. At the assessing time, N addition alone significantly increased LNC a and LNC a /LPC a ratio of Stipa bungeana (C 3 grass) only, while P Nmax increased significantly in all three species. Under N addition, P addition caused significantly lower LNC a , but higher PNUE and P Nmax in Bothriochloa isch aemum (C 4 grass) and Stipa bungeana . The LNC a , P Nmax , and PNUE of Lespedeza davurica (C 3 legume) increased significantly after P addition regardless of N application. The LNC a /LPC a for optimum PNUE changed with species. The P Nmax and PNUE of Bothriochloa ischaemum and Stipa bungeana had a peak when LNC a /LPC a attained ~ 11 and ~ 20. Lespedeza davurica tended to retain greater P Nmax and PNUE at lower LNC a /LPC a . Our results indicated that the C 3 grass was more sensitive to N and P addition than the C 4 grass and the C 3 legume in terms of leaf N and P contents and P Nmax . Such interspecific variations of nutrient use in response to N and/or P addition are favorable for maintaining the diversity and the stability of the grassland community.
